A 73-year-old man was admitted with the suspicion of appendiceal abscess. Emergency appendectomy was done. Histology revealed two tumours, an adenocarcinoma and a carcinoid. Tumours of the appendix are seldom diagnosed preoperatively and often first at microscopic examination. All specimens should therefore be histologically examined.
